A15QS Amp-Trap® Form 101 Semiconductor Protection fuses were designed for the specific protection of diodes and other semiconductor devices rated 150VAC/DC. The A15QS product line's compact design is perfect for those applications that have limitations on available space.

Protection of AC/DC drives, UPS, Rectifiers and other equipment of 150 volts or less
Low I²t minimizes damage to protected components on short circuit. Controlled arc voltage reduces stress to circuit components during fuse clearing. Choice of mounting types provides options for unique termination requirements
